> h3. Why
> These need to be clearly demarcated from user code. We will use a common prefix, e.g. MyCBindingMethod becomes geode_MyCBindingMethod.
> *As a .net core extension developer*
> *I want to be able to clearly distinguish a .net call from a p/Invoke into a library*
> *So that I don't get confused*
> h3. Acceptance Criteria
> dumping exports via {{link /dump /exports}} or {{otool -L}} and grepping for the geode___ prefix gives the full list of C bindings used by our .net core code.
